Output 42a344d97406d6b4b6e35c870aeab82e8965559ab0c6847673084e7d226f5984:77

value
74943
script pubkey
OP_0 OP_PUSHBYTES_32 705d0fa75ea300db68f93749e46d07b6f591c2b945cc7f26219bc42962068e63
address
bc1qwpwslf675vqdk68exay7gmg8km6ers4eghx87f3pn0zzjcsx3e3sjzr4p0
transaction
42a344d97406d6b4b6e35c870aeab82e8965559ab0c6847673084e7d226f5984
spent
true